Early Life and Literary Beginnings
H2: Salman Rushdie's Background
Salman Rushdie was born on June 19, 1947, in Bombay (now Mumbai), India. Growing up in a multicultural environment, Rushdie developed a deep appreciation for storytelling and literature. He pursued English literature at the University of Cambridge, laying the foundation for his future career as a novelist.
H3: Breakthrough with Midnight's Children
Rushdie's debut novel, Midnight's Children (1981), established him as a formidable literary figure. The book won the Booker Prize and later the Booker of Bookers, cementing his status in the literary world.
